236#[must_use]
240pub fn detect_browser(path: &Path) -> Option<BrowserFamily> {
241 let name = path.file_name()?.to_string_lossy().to_lowercase();
242 let path_str = path.to_string_lossy().to_lowercase();
243
244 if path_str.contains("safari") {
246 let safari_files = [
247 "history.db",
248 "cookies.db",
249 "downloads.plist",
250 "bookmarks.plist",
251 ];
252 if safari_files.contains(&name.as_str()) {
253 return Some(BrowserFamily::Safari);
254 }
255 }
256
257 let chromium_vendors = [
259 "chrome", "chromium", "edge", "brave", "opera", "vivaldi", "arc",
260 ];
261 let is_chromium_path = chromium_vendors.iter().any(|b| path_str.contains(b));
262 let chromium_files = ["history", "cookies", "login data", "web data", "bookmarks"];
263 if chromium_files.contains(&name.as_str()) && is_chromium_path {
264 return Some(BrowserFamily::Chromium);
265 }
266
267 if name == "places.sqlite" || name == "formhistory.sqlite" {
269 return Some(BrowserFamily::Firefox);
270 }
271 let firefox_files = [
272 "cookies.sqlite",
273 "logins.json",
274 "extensions.json",
275 "sessionstore.jsonlz4",
276 ];
277 if firefox_files.contains(&name.as_str())
278 && (path_str.contains("firefox") || path_str.contains("mozilla"))
279 {
280 return Some(BrowserFamily::Firefox);
281 }
282
283 None
284}
